A parallel; in the manner of Plutarch : between a most celebrated man of Florence; and one, scarce ever heard of, in England.

Print Book, English, 1758
Printed at Strawberry-Hill, by William Robinson; and sold by Messieurs Dodsley, at Tully's-Head, Pall-Mall; for the benefit of Mr. Hill, [Strawberry-Hill], 1758
104 pages ; 20 cm (8vo)
1008023119
700 copies printed
Copy [A] with 4 portraits inserted
Copy [A] with the bookplates of William Turner and Edward Vernon Utterson
Copy [B] donated by the Rev. Alexander Dyce
Copy [C] donated by John Forster
Hazen, Strawberry Hill Press, 6
Portrait of Magliabecchi
The men compared are Antonio Magliabechi and Robert Hill, a poor tailor of Buckingham
